Problems like the one below could become the norm in the future. Who's to say after paying off a 30 mortgage you may not even own your home. What seems to count is what the banks say...

Quote:
Warren Nyerges opened his front door in Naples, Fla., to find a scraggly-haired summons server standing on his stoop. He plopped a foreclosure notice from Bank of America in Nyerges' hands. But Nyerges had paid for his house in cash. And he'd never had a checking account, much less a mortgage, with Bank of America
.

AP IMPACT: Caught by Mistake in Foreclosure Web - ABC News
